Spectrum News launches new channel in Tennessee


This is an interesting one given that Spectrum is best known in New York and Los Angeles for their newscasts.

  • Spectrum News Tennessee is available to Spectrum TV customers on channel 1 and through the Spectrum News app and connected TV platforms.
  • The channel offers local headlines every 15 minutes and weather updates every 10 minutes.
  • The launch expands Spectrum News’ growing portfolio of local and streaming news services; over the past year, Spectrum News has launched regional channels in Northern California and New England.
Spectrum News has expanded its local television news footprint with the launch of Spectrum News Tennessee, a 24-hour news network serving Spectrum TV customers across the state.

The channel is now available on channel 1 for Spectrum subscribers and can also be accessed through the Spectrum News mobile app, the Xumo Stream Box, Roku and Apple TV devices.

Spectrum News Tennessee will provide local headlines every 15 minutes and weather forecasts every 10 minutes, following the format used across the company’s other regional news operations.
